This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] ADS131M02:为方便我参考、您能否为我提供 ADS131M02驱动器?

Guru**** 2390735 points
Other Parts Discussed in Thread: ADS131M02
请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/data-converters-group/data-converters/f/data-converters-forum/1396296/ads131m02-for-my-reference-could-you-please-offer-me-the-ads131m02-driver

器件型号:ADS131M02

工具与软件:

请告知我如何将 DRDY 引脚用于 SPI 接口与 ADS131M02、因为我有一些相关的问题。 如果您有参考代码、请告诉我。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Pavan:

    /DRDY 引脚是一个低电平有效输出、指示新转换数据何时就绪、因此您可以使用/DRDY 信号(下降沿)作为微控制器的中断。 您可以 在中断子例程代码中向 ADC 发送 RREG 或 WREG 命令。

    ADS131M02数据表已显示代码示例、请参阅 ADS131M02数据表中9.1.6代码示例的部分。 此外、还可以从 ADS131M02产品页面下的"设计和开发"选项卡下载示例代码。

    SBAC254  ADS131M0x 示例 C 代码

    -戴尔

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    我当前使用 DRDY 引脚、因为需要在该引脚为低电平时运行读取寄存器函数。 我能够通过此命令获取正确的寄存器值。 是否正确使用了 DRDY 引脚?

    如果(HAL_GPIO_ReadPin (DRDY_GPIO_Port、DRDY_Pin)== GPIO_PIN_RESET)

    ADC_DATA = READ_ADC_Data ();//读取 ADC 数据

    HAL_DELAY (100);

    HAL_GPIO_WritePin (DRDY_GPIO_Port、DRDY_Pin、GPIO_PIN_SET);

    }

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Pavan:

    用于识别问题的时序始终优于代码。 我要在 E2E 论坛上的另一个主题中为您提供有关同一 ADC 的支持、让我们重点关注您的所有问题。 该主题已关闭。

    BR、

    戴尔